Refine Review
The investment casting procedure stands apart for its capability to produce elaborate aluminum parts with impressive precision and detail. This approach starts with creating a wax or polymer pattern that is a reproduction of the wanted component. Next off, the pattern is coated with a ceramic covering, which is then heated to harden. When the covering is established, the wax is disappeared, leaving a tooth cavity in the covering. Fluid aluminum is put into this tooth cavity, loading it to form the last component. After cooling down, the ceramic shell is damaged away, disclosing the actors component. This process enables for complicated geometries and fine surface area finishes, making it appropriate for numerous applications, from aerospace to auto markets.

Die Casting Performance
Although numerous casting approaches are available, die casting stands out for its performance, specifically in high-volume manufacturing situations. This technique employs high-pressure pressures to infuse liquified aluminum into a mold, causing fast cycle times and constant item top quality. Compared to sand casting and investment casting, pass away casting significantly decreases material waste and permits complex designs with limited tolerances. The capability to generate huge amounts of parts promptly makes it suitable for markets such as automotive and durable goods. Furthermore, die casting can help with making use of cheaper alloys, better improving its cost-effectiveness. Overall, the effectiveness of die casting makes it a preferred option for producers intending to optimize both production rate and quality.

Sector Applications of Aluminum Castings
Aluminum castings play an important role across various industries due to their lightweight, corrosion-resistant residential or commercial properties and outstanding strength-to-weight ratio. In the automobile industry, aluminum castings are extensively used for engine parts, transmission real estates, and architectural parts, adding to fuel effectiveness and performance. The aerospace industry take advantage of aluminum castings in airplane frameworks, engine installs, and interior fittings, where weight decrease is essential.
Furthermore, the consumer electronics industry uses aluminum castings for enclosures and components, boosting longevity while keeping a sleek visual. In the building and construction market, aluminum castings are utilized in architectural elements, window structures, and architectural supports, giving strength against weathering. The marine field favors aluminum castings for boat hulls and installations due to their resistance to saltwater deterioration. In general, aluminum castings offer flexible services, fulfilling varied requirements throughout different applications while keeping high performance and dependability.
